Re: 240L non starter

Postby datman » Tue Jul 27, 2010 11:49 pm

sounds like flooded.. bit of dirt in the needle valve. window on carb will be full rather than half way up..

clean /polish needle valve. hopefully fixed.
also check return line to tank is not blocked as that can cause too much fuel pressure at the needle valve

Re: 240L non starter

Postby datman » Mon Aug 02, 2010 6:37 pm

1 at front, order 153624 anticlockwise distributor rotation. there should be a line on the dizzy cap , near one of the clips, which shows where number1 should be. surely it was running before?
